The answer may surprise you:
Household Hazardous Wastes (wastes generated in households) are not regulated as hazardous wastes by the United States Environmental Protection Agency (USEPA) or any state government within the 50 states.
Since 1980, the USEPA has excluded all wastes generated by households from regulation as hazardous waste, and all 50 states [...]
